Nov. 11 -- A memorable day in history of all world. At 11 A.M., fighting between Germany and Allies ceased and Armistice was signed. French decorated with flags. Left office early. Big parade and celebrating that night. L'Hotel de Ville & Palace of Justice were lit up. fireworks were displayed and people made merry. Most everybody drunk. Went with Miss Proper and bunch of girls to see the celebrations. Beaucoup fun. "FINIS LE GUERRE."

Met Henry Portyridal from Brookline, Mass.

Nov. 12-Tues. Worked. French still celebrating. At night, Jeanette & another friend of Gordon's, (sgt. Carr) Gordon and I went out to celebrate. Got horns, flags and had some fun. Back at 10 P.M.
